Salt Spring Adventure Co. is a marine-based tour operator based in Ganges, British Columbia on Salt Spring Island. The company offers a range of guided and self-guided experiences across the Salish Sea, including whale watching aboard a 27ft Zodiac, small-group marine wildlife zodiac tours, private charters, and multiple kayak rental and guided kayak options.
Guided trips include the Whale Watching Tour focused on spotting Transient Orcas and Humpback whales, and the Marine Wildlife Zodiac Tour that highlights Bald Eagles, harbor seals and coastal scenery. Small-group guided kayak experiences — such as the Chocolate Beach Kayak Tours (three- and four-hour options) and the Goat Island Kayak Tour — are led by certified guides who provide interpretation, route planning, and safety oversight.
Private charter options use a 12-passenger Zodiac capable of swift 28-knot cruises around the Southern Gulf Islands and can be customized for celebrations, team-building, or private sightseeing with pickup options available. Self-guided rentals include sit-on-top and sea kayaks in single and double configurations, with well-maintained equipment supplied for guests.
Safety and education are central to the operator’s approach: knowledgeable captains and certified guides emphasize conservation, wildlife etiquette, and responsible tourism while providing instruction and gear. Tours run from Ganges and focus on small groups and intimate experiences to reduce disturbance to wildlife and maximize viewing opportunities. The company’s offerings make Salt Spring Island’s marine ecosystems accessible to families, nature enthusiasts, and paddlers of varying experience levels. Wear Layers for Nighttime Cooling
Temperatures can drop quickly after sunset, so bring a lightweight jacket or fleece to stay warm during the paddle.
Bring a Headlamp or Waterproof Flashlight
Although guides provide some lighting, carrying your own light helps with safety and enhances the experience on the water.
Use Reef-Safe Sunscreen
Apply reef-safe sunscreen to protect your skin and the delicate marine environment even during evening tours.
Arrive 15 Minutes Early for Orientation
Timely arrival ensures a smooth check-in and safety briefing before heading out on the water.
